Tokyo confirms 11,018 new COVID-19 cases

An aerial view of central Tokyo
17:42 JST, July 19, 2022
Tokyo logged 11,018 new cases of novel coronavirus infection on Tuesday, the Tokyo metropolitan government said.
The number fell 493 from the same day of the previous week, down for the first time week-on-week in 32 days, partly because fewer tests were conducted due to the three-day weekend.
